news 2026/4/16 10:38:57

B站视频本地化保存:从链接到离线观看的完整解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
B站视频本地化保存:从链接到离线观看的完整解决方案

在数字内容消费日益普及的今天,视频已成为人们获取信息、学习知识和娱乐放松的重要载体。然而,网络环境的不可控性往往成为优质内容消费的最大障碍。BilibiliVideoDownload作为一款专业的跨平台桌面应用,为用户提供了将在线视频转化为本地资源的有效途径。

【免费下载链接】BilibiliVideoDownload项目地址: https://gitcode.com/gh_mirrors/bi/BilibiliVideoDownload

技术架构深度解析:现代桌面应用的设计哲学

BilibiliVideoDownload采用Electron+Vue3+TypeScript的技术栈,这一组合体现了现代桌面应用开发的最佳实践。

渲染进程与主进程分离:通过ContextBridge技术实现安全的数据交换,避免了传统Node.js集成模式的安全隐患。这种架构设计确保了应用在保持功能丰富性的同时,兼顾了系统安全性。

模块化设计理念:整个应用按照功能模块进行清晰划分,从核心的B站API调用、媒体文件处理,到用户界面组件,每一层都遵循单一职责原则。

星空主题的主界面设计,既美观又实用,为用户提供愉悦的操作体验

核心能力展示:超越简单下载的多维度功能

智能视频类型识别系统

工具能够自动识别多种B站视频类型,包括普通视频、番剧系列、多P教学内容和公开影视资源。这种智能识别能力基于对B站API的深度理解,能够准确解析视频元数据并提取关键信息。

完整媒体资源获取链

不同于简单的视频文件下载,BilibiliVideoDownload提供完整的媒体包下载方案:

  • 视频文件:支持从320P到8K超高清的多种清晰度
  • 弹幕数据:同步获取实时弹幕,保留社区互动氛围
  • 字幕文件:自动下载视频字幕,便于学习和翻译
  • 封面图片:保存视频封面,完善媒体库管理

多平台兼容性设计

基于Electron框架的跨平台特性,确保在Windows、macOS和Linux系统上都能提供一致的用户体验。这种设计理念体现了现代软件开发对用户多样性的充分考虑。

操作流程重构:从用户视角重新定义下载体验

第一步:链接输入与智能解析

用户在星空背景的主界面中输入B站视频链接,系统立即启动智能解析引擎。这个过程不仅仅是简单的链接验证,而是对视频内容的深度分析。

清晰度选择对话框提供完整的画质选项,满足不同场景需求

第二步:参数配置与资源选择

根据视频类型的不同,用户需要进行的配置也有所差异:

单视频场景:直接选择目标清晰度即可开始下载多P视频场景:需要先选择具体的P数,再确定画质参数

第三步:下载监控与成果验证

下载过程中,用户可以实时查看任务进度。完成后,系统会自动将视频信息添加到下载历史列表,方便后续管理和播放。

下载历史界面详细展示每个视频的完整信息和统计

进阶应用技巧:充分发挥工具潜能的专业指南

账号权限优化策略

通过登录B站账号,用户可以解锁更高级的下载权限:

  • 普通账号:支持最高1080P清晰度下载
  • 高级会员:支持8K超高清和杜比视界等高级格式

批量处理效率提升

对于多P视频和系列内容,工具的批量下载功能能够显著提升效率。合理设置同时下载任务数量(建议2-5个),可以在保证下载质量的同时最大化利用网络带宽。

存储空间智能管理

建议按照内容类型、下载时间或主题分类建立文件夹结构,便于后期查找和维护。

实际应用案例分析:不同用户群体的使用场景

教育工作者:构建离线教学资源库

某高校教师使用BilibiliVideoDownload下载技术教程视频,建立个人教学资源库。在无网络环境的实验室中,学生依然能够观看高质量的教学内容,显著提升了教学效果。

内容创作者:灵感收集与竞品分析

视频制作团队通过下载优秀作品进行离线分析,研究拍摄手法、剪辑技巧和内容策划,为自身创作提供参考。

技术学习者:建立知识体系

编程学习者下载系列教程视频,按照学习进度建立分类文件夹。通勤路上、图书馆等无网络环境下,依然能够持续学习,有效利用碎片时间。

多P视频下载支持精准选择,满足用户对特定内容的需求

技术实现细节:深入了解工具工作原理

视频解析机制

工具通过调用B站官方API获取视频信息,包括标题、UP主、时长、清晰度选项等关键数据。这一过程确保了下载内容的准确性和完整性。

音视频合成流程

由于B站采用音视频分离的存储策略,下载完成后需要使用FFmpeg进行合成。这种设计虽然增加了安装包体积,但保证了最终视频文件的质量。

用户数据安全保护

采用SESSDATA方式进行身份验证,仅获取必要的会话数据,不涉及用户敏感信息,确保了使用过程的安全性。

使用规范与最佳实践

版权合规使用

请严格遵守相关法律法规,仅下载个人观看用途的公开视频内容。尊重内容创作者的劳动成果,合理使用下载功能。

系统资源优化

根据设备性能和网络状况,合理设置同时下载任务数量。避免过多任务导致系统资源耗尽,影响正常使用。

定期维护建议

建议定期清理不需要的下载记录和视频文件,保持应用运行效率和存储空间充足。

未来发展方向:持续优化的技术路线

随着B站平台的不断升级和用户需求的多样化,BilibiliVideoDownload也在持续迭代优化:

  • 支持更多视频格式和编码标准
  • 优化用户界面和操作体验
  • 提升下载速度和稳定性

通过BilibiliVideoDownload,用户能够真正实现视频内容的自主管理,摆脱网络环境的限制。无论是学习提升、工作参考还是娱乐放松,这款工具都能为用户提供可靠的技术支持,让优质视频内容触手可及。

【免费下载链接】BilibiliVideoDownload项目地址: https://gitcode.com/gh_mirrors/bi/BilibiliVideoDownload

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/12 9:28:24

揭秘R语言与GPT融合技巧:5步实现智能数据分析自动化

第一章:揭秘R语言与GPT融合的核心价值将R语言的统计计算能力与GPT的自然语言生成优势相结合,正在重塑数据分析的工作流。这种融合不仅提升了数据解读的效率,还让非技术用户也能通过对话式界面参与复杂分析。增强数据洞察的可解释性 GPT能够将…

作者头像 李华
网站建设 2026/4/12 22:16:04

突破音乐格式壁垒:qmcdump让你的QQ音乐随处可听

突破音乐格式壁垒:qmcdump让你的QQ音乐随处可听 【免费下载链接】qmcdump 一个简单的QQ音乐解码(qmcflac/qmc0/qmc3 转 flac/mp3),仅为个人学习参考用。 项目地址: https://gitcode.com/gh_mirrors/qm/qmcdump 你是否曾为Q…

作者头像 李华
网站建设 2026/4/15 16:43:43

字符+拼音混合输入纠错机制,解决中文多音字发音难题

字符拼音混合输入纠错机制,解决中文多音字发音难题 在语音合成技术日益渗透到短视频、虚拟主播和有声书创作的今天,一个看似微小却影响深远的问题正被越来越多创作者关注:为什么“重庆”总是被读成‘zhng qng’?为什么“行”在“…

作者头像 李华
网站建设 2026/4/16 12:13:43

Degrees of Lewdity中文汉化配置完整解决方案

Degrees of Lewdity中文汉化配置完整解决方案 【免费下载链接】Degrees-of-Lewdity-Chinese-Localization Degrees of Lewdity 游戏的授权中文社区本地化版本 项目地址: https://gitcode.com/gh_mirrors/de/Degrees-of-Lewdity-Chinese-Localization 还在为英文界面困扰…

作者头像 李华
网站建设 2026/4/16 12:14:18

qmcdump:彻底解放你的QQ音乐收藏,跨平台播放无障碍

你是否曾经为QQ音乐下载的歌曲无法在其他设备上播放而烦恼?那些神秘的.qmcflac、.qmc0、.qmc3文件,就像被限制了访问权限的音乐宝库,只能在特定的播放器中才能打开。今天,我要向你推荐一款能够完美解决这个问题的开源工具——qmcd…

作者头像 李华
网站建设 2026/4/15 15:25:02

深蓝词库转换工具终极指南:3分钟实现跨平台输入法无缝迁移

深蓝词库转换工具终极指南:3分钟实现跨平台输入法无缝迁移 【免费下载链接】imewlconverter ”深蓝词库转换“ 一款开源免费的输入法词库转换程序 项目地址: https://gitcode.com/gh_mirrors/im/imewlconverter 还在为更换设备后输入习惯被打断而烦恼吗&…

作者头像 李华